Analyzing the Problem of Your Windows


When evaluating the condition of windows, house owners should perform a thorough evaluation to identify any indicators of wear or damage. This consists of checking for cracks in the glass, which can endanger power effectiveness and safety and security. Additionally, they should check out the window frameworks and sills for mold and mildew, warping, or rot, as these problems can suggest much deeper structural problems. Home owners ought to also examine the seals around the windows; worn or damaged seals can bring about drafts and raised energy costs.

Another crucial aspect is examining the procedure of the home windows. Are they very easy to open and close? Do they secure firmly? Problem in procedure may recommend that the home windows require repair work or substitute. Lastly, bearing in mind of any kind of condensation between panes can indicate seal failing in dual or triple-glazed windows. By performing this substantial analysis, home owners can make enlightened choices concerning whether to repair or replace their home windows.

Energy Performance Considerations

Energy effectiveness plays an essential role in the choice between home window substitute and repair work, as obsolete or broken windows can substantially impact a home's energy usage. Windows that are poorly sealed or have single-pane glass enable drafts and heat loss, bring about enhanced heating and cooling prices. In comparison, contemporary dual or triple-pane home windows with innovative insulation innovations can markedly boost energy efficiency, reducing energy costs and boosting comfort.

When considering repair work, house owners must analyze whether renovations can be made to existing windows to enhance their power efficiency. Simple solutions, such as resealing or including weather removing, may be enough for minor concerns. However, if home windows are badly compromised, substitute may be the more reliable long-lasting remedy.
